Bean-to-cup machines are ideal for those who appreciate the delicious aroma and flavor of freshly ground coffee. They provide a wide range of advantages including convenience and customization.

philips-4300-series-bean-to-cup-espresso-machine-lattego-milk-frother-8-coffee-variaties-intuitive-display-black-ep4346-70-1847.jpgThese machines come with a menu of popular coffee shop drinks displayed on the screen, meaning you can enjoy barista-style drinks at the push of a button.

Freshly ground coffee freshly ground

Bean-to-cup equipment is a great alternative for companies that are increasingly concerned about sustainability. They produce minimal waste, and they don't need materials that are used only once, like pods or sachets. This means they help to reduce the amount of trash your office produces.

Freshness is another benefit of this type coffee machine. Whole beans are ground right before brewing, which minimises the loss of essential oils that give coffee its flavor and aroma. In the end, the fresh taste of freshly ground coffee is hard to beat.

Many of these machines offer a variety of settings so you can alter the strength, temperature, and milk froth for each cup. This level of control makes it ideal for coffee drinkers who want to create the perfect drink every time they use the machine.

Many of the bean-to-cup models available integrate mobile apps. This allows you to access a variety of recipes, monitor maintenance programs and even adjust the temperature of the water. This is great for offices that are busy and need to be able to serve high-quality coffee on demand.

Some of the best value bean to cup coffee machine machines on the market will also assess the quality of the water that is in your home, and will advise you on which filters to install. This will prevent the taste of your coffee being metallic, which is usually caused by minerals such as iron and copper.

Additionally, some of the higher-end bean-to-cup machines have an integrated grinder and a milk frother. This will save time and effort since you don't need to take out separate equipment for each drink. This is perfect for large offices and companies who need to prepare many drinks throughout the day.

The only disadvantage of the bean-to-cup machine is that it can be more expensive than other kinds of coffee machines that are self-service, as it requires the purchase of whole beans instead of pre-packaged sachets or pods. However, the expense can be offset by saving money on coffee shop visits and being capable of keeping a supply of beans in your office for when guests come to visit.

Variety of drinks

The appeal of a bean-to-cup coffee maker is that it can produce an array of drinks. From basic black coffee and espresso to luscious cappuccino and latte, the machine can cater for a wide range of tastes. It is also possible to alter the settings on these machines to adapt them to your exact requirements. You can alter the strength of the beans, the grind size and even the temperature of the water to make a drink that is perfect for you.

Certain machines can also be set up to prepare two different milk-based beverages at the same time. This saves your time and lets you serve more customers simultaneously. The convenience and customization of bean to cup machines is what makes them so popular. It's important to note that some people prefer an individualized approach to coffee-making and want to be in control of the final product.

For many businesses, especially golf clubs, leisure centres, hotels and restaurants, a bean-to-cup machine is a good choice. The machines are easy to use and do not require any training, and take up less room than traditional espresso machines. They are also more reliable and can handle larger quantities of customers than other coffee makers.

A majority of bean-to-cup machines feature modern designs that make them a great addition to any commercial kitchen. Smeg's bean-to-cup coffee maker is a fantastic illustration of this. It features a modern design that looks at right at home in any modern office. However, some models are larger than others and may be difficult to fit into smaller spaces.

There are numerous bean-to-cup machines that can be found at a reasonable price to meet all budgets and needs. Some models are small and won't take much counter space. You can find models with more advanced features, like robust grinders and a larger selection of drink recipes (some even have 19). You might be able to catch a bargain in the sales or get a business coffee machine rental deal that will help you save even more money.

Flexibility

Bean-to-cup equipment, unlike pod machines, which rely on preground coffee, or pods of coffee, allow you to choose the beans machines and drinks that you'd like to create. This gives you greater flexibility and control over the aroma, taste and flavor of your drink. In addition, many models offer two hoppers that allows you to switch effortlessly between different varieties of beans.

Another advantage of bean-to-cup machines is that they can deliver a high-quality drink every time and without the requirement for manual intervention. This makes them the perfect option for busy cafes, offices, and other commercial spaces. The most popular models from brands like La Cimbali can produce up to 200 cups per day and are therefore ideal for large-scale businesses.

In addition to offering a higher standard of coffee, a bean-to cup machine can also be more affordable than a conventional model. This is because you'll cut back on the expense of purchasing and storing expensive pods and coffee beans, and can buy cheaper bulk beans. In addition there are many models that require less maintenance than their pod-based counterparts and don't rely on expensive cartridges.

It's not surprising that bean-to cup machines are gaining popularity in homes. However, when you're looking for a home coffee maker you'll need to consider factors like size and capacity, as well as what type of drinks you're likely enjoying the most. For instance, if you're an avid drinker of cappuccino, then you'll need an appliance that can make quality milk foam.

You'll need to take into account the amount of space available in your kitchen. Some models can take up a lot of space. Check the product dimensions before choosing a bean-to-cup coffee machine.

There's a broad range of designs and colours to choose from when picking a bean-to-cup machine, so you're bound to find one that suits the aesthetic of your home. A lot of top-of-the-line machines from brands like SMEG and Sage have a sleek, modern design that will fit with the decor of your home.

Easy to clean

A lot of coffee machines have cleaning programs built-in that run every day to remove any remaining smells or oils. Cleaning tablets (such ones made by Caffenu), or descalers, can be used regularly to keep your machine in top condition.

Most bean-to-cup machines come with a container for used grounds. These grounds can be used for many different purposes and are better for the environment than single use pods and sachets which pollute waterways and landfills.

Most beans-to cup coffee machines have an integrated milk system which cleans and rinses itself off after each use. This removes any milk residue that clings inside the milk pipes. This is an issue that traditional espresso machines suffer from. This will also stop the accumulation in the milk circuits with bacteria, which could cause a sour taste in drinks and cause damage to your machine.

Additionally, the majority of bean-to-cup machines will come with a set of brushes to clean the steam pipe as well as other parts that are more difficult to access the machine. These brushes are ideal for cleaning the machine and removing any dirt. They will also help to eliminate any smells.

If you're looking for a more convenient and easy method to prepare their beverages, bean-to-cup machines are a great choice. The machines are simple to use and don't require any special skills. This means that everyone in your office can prepare coffee, saving time and money.

coffeee-logo-300x100-png.pngBean-to-cup machines are a ideal alternative for businesses with a high staff turnover. This includes hair salons and offices. They reduce the requirement for barista training and support. They're an excellent choice for those who want the flexibility and quality of a bean to cup machine, but can't afford to hire a barista. With a range of sizes and price points that can be adapted to any budget, it's possible for any business to offer premium coffee.
